The positives in the clubs are increasing. Football goes into “hibernation”

by admin

The pandemic hits football and sport again. The increase in positive cases and the government’s anti-contagion provisions condition the performance of the activity.

The minor leagues and the youth leagues were the first to pay for the restrictions. Following the example of Veneto and Lombardy, the Liguria Football Federation has decided to extend the Christmas break up to one month. Having gone on vacation after the round on Saturday 19, the last one before Christmas, the Promotion, First and Second category championships, as well as all the youth activities, should have resumed their journey on Sunday 9 January. Instead, what will be a real “lethargy” will last until the weekend of 22 and 23 January, barring complications.

At the moment it remains confirmed within the established terms, at least at the regulation level, for the D series and the Excellence, with the next rounds still on the bill for 9 January and preceded, for the D series, by some recoveries (including Bra -Sanremese and Imperia-Casale) scheduled for Wednesday 5.

The dynamics, however, are constantly evolving and, beyond what is established by the FIGC and the Amateur League, everything will be subject to the number of infected in the various clubs. Imperia itself (two infected and all the staff and staff subjected to tampons) suspended the activity which, barring further aggravations, should resume today.

«In these situations – said the president of the Imperia Fabrizio Gramondo – it would be advisable to think about a postponement of all the championships, shortening the Easter holidays or not observing the subsequent stoppages in April. On the other hand, it has also been seen that in winter the weather repercussions are also serious, with many empty trips due to matches postponed due to snow or storms. It would be advisable to think for the next few years, for the minor championships, a long winter break, as in Germany and Northern Europe ».

Further complicating the path are the new government provisions regarding the vaccination of players. From 10 January only vaccinated players will be able to take the field. An example is the case of Vladimir Mikhaylovskiy, the Russian defender of the Sanremese and the only white-blue athlete to have so far refused to undergo vaccination.

“After several days of reflection – says the club – the player has decided to follow the line of the blue-and-white club which, even before the choice of the government that from January 10 will impose the vaccination obligation on all athletes, had already expressly requested vaccination to its members. The Russian defender will therefore act as soon as possible ». –
